
現在、単なる質問に答えるだけでなく、より多くのことができるAIエージェントについて多くの話題が飛び交っています。顧客のチケットを解決したり、ITリクエストをトリアージしたり、コードベースのバグを見つけて修正したりするなど、ワークフロー全体を自動化できる高度なエージェントへのシフトが見られます。
Anthropicは、この分野の中心にあり、強力な新しいツールキットであるClaude Code SDKを提供しています。これは、開発者がカスタムAIエージェントをゼロから構築するために必要なツールを提供するように設計されています。しかし、その可能性は大きいものの、実際に何にサインアップしているのかを理解するために少し時間を取る価値があります。
このガイドでは、Claude Code SDKの概要をストレートに紹介します。何であるか、何ができるか、そしてそれを使って構築する際の実際の現実(隠れたコストを含む)を見ていきます。結局のところ、AIエージェントをゼロから構築することがあなたのビジネスにとって正しい選択なのか、それとも求める結果を得るためのより速く、効率的な方法があるのかという一つの質問に帰結します。
Claude Code SDKとは?
簡単に言えば、Claude Code SDKは、開発者がAnthropicのAIモデルであるClaudeを制御するためのコードを書くことができるツールキットです。完成品というよりは、原材料と重機が揃ったプロの作業場のようなものと考えてください。エンジン、配線、シャーシは手に入りますが、車を組み立てるのは自分自身です。
SDKは、PythonやTypeScriptなどの人気のあるプログラミング言語で利用可能なので、開発チームは既に良く知っている言語で作業できます。
その主な役割は、単なるチャットウィンドウを超えた自動化エージェントを開発者が構築できるようにすることです。これらのエージェントは、ファイルの読み書き、サーバー上でのコマンド実行、他のツールとの接続を行い、複雑なマルチステップのタスクを処理します。これは、一度限りのAIクエリから、本物のAI駆動の労働力を構築することへの移行です。
Claude Code SDKで構築できるもの
ここからが面白いところです。AIにシステムとやり取りする能力を与えると、まったく新しいレベルの自動化が可能になります。ここでは、チームがそれを使って構築しているものを少し覗いてみましょう。
開発者のワークフローの自動化
エンジニアリングチームにとって、SDKは常に手作業で高価だったタスクに対する大きな時間節約になります。まるで24時間365日呼び出し可能な疲れ知らずのジュニア開発者がいるようなものです。
いくつかの実際の例を挙げます:
-
自動コードレビュー: AIエージェントは、開発者が提出する新しいコードをすべてスキャンできます。一般的なセキュリティの欠陥をチェックし、コードが会社のスタイルガイドに従っていることを確認し、シニア開発者が目を通す前に改善を提案するようにプログラムできます。
-
CI/CD統合: エージェントを開発パイプラインに直接組み込むことができます。開発者が新機能をプッシュすると、エージェントはコードの変更を見て詳細なリリースノートを自動的に作成したり、新機能を反映するために技術文書を更新したりできます。
-
SREとオンコールアシスタント: 本番環境で何かが壊れたとき、1秒でも重要です。Claude Code SDKで構築されたエージェントはすぐに飛び込み、サーバーログを読み、診断コマンドを実行し、インシデントをトリアージします。初期の作業を処理し、オンコールエンジニアが問題を迅速に解決できるように重要な情報をすべて集めます。
ビジネスアシスタントの作成
この技術は開発者だけのものではありません。同じアイデアを適用して、会社のほぼすべての部門のためにAIエージェントを構築することができます。
Anthropicはいくつかの興味深いユースケースを指摘しています:
-
法務アシスタント: エージェントは契約書をスキャンし、会社の基準を満たさない条項をフラグ付けしたり、数千ページの法的文書の中で潜在的なリスクを特定したりすることができます。これらは人間が行うよりもはるかに短時間で行われます。
-
金融アドバイザー: 財務システムに接続することで、エージェントはレポートを分析し、支出の傾向を見つけ、予測を支援し、財務チームに必要なときに確固たるデータ駆動の洞察を提供します。
-
カスタマーサポートエージェント: これは最も一般的なアプリケーションの一つです。内部システムやデータベースと直接やり取りすることで、高度な技術的な顧客問題を解決する完全にカスタムなAIエージェントを構築できます。
プロのヒント: これらの高度なユースケースの背後にある本当の秘訣は、SDKがモデルコンテキストプロトコル(MCP)を使用してカスタムツールに接続できる能力です。これにより、開発者はClaudeと会社のプライベートAPI、データベース、内部サービスの間に橋を架けることができます。エージェントに実際に作業を完了するために必要なコンテキストを提供します。
Claude Code SDKの隠れたコスト
可能性は素晴らしいですが、Claude Code SDKを使って構築することは簡単なことではありません。これは、最初から明らかでない重い隠れたコストと複雑さを伴う真剣なプロジェクトです。
Claude Code SDKが重いエンジニアリングを必要とする理由
まず、SDKは開発者向けのツールであり、プラグアンドプレイのソリューションではありません。クールなアイデアから生産準備が整ったAIエージェントに到達するには、エンジニアリングチームへの大きな投資が必要です。
-
適切な種類のエンジニアが必要: これを任せるのはどの開発者でも良いわけではありません。PythonやTypeScriptに精通し、AIプロンプト、エージェントワークフローの設計、難しいAPI統合の取り扱いに経験のあるシニアエンジニアが必要です。そのような才能は高価で見つけるのが容易ではありません。
-
すぐに成果が出るわけではない: これは週末プロジェクトではありません。信頼性のあるAIエージェントを設計、構築、テスト、展開することは、数週間、場合によっては数ヶ月かかる大規模な取り組みです。投資のリターンを見るまでに長い時間がかかります。
-
仕事は本当に終わらない: 一度立ち上げたら終わりではありません。内部システム、API、コードベースが変わるにつれて、AIエージェントは壊れないように常に更新とメンテナンスが必要です。これは継続的な運用コストであり、考慮に入れる必要があります。
複雑さと予測不可能なコストの管理
最初の構築を超えて、DIYアプローチは、あなたを遅らせ、リスクをもたらす主要な運用上の頭痛を伴います。
-
設定することが多すぎる: エージェントを正しく動作させるために、開発者はすべてをコードで管理する必要があります。つまり、システムプロンプトを書くことでその性格を定義し、使用するすべてのツールに特定の権限を設定し、会話履歴を管理し、堅実なエラーハンドリングを行う必要があります。これは多くのことを同時に行う必要があります。
-
セキュリティと権限: SDKはAIがファイルシステムとやり取りすることを可能にします。それが強力である理由ですが、同時に少し怖いです。エージェントが間違ったファイルを削除したり、機密データにアクセスしたりしないように、厳格なセキュリティガードレールを設定する責任は完全にあなたのチームにあります。
-
予想外のAPI請求: Hacker Newsの一部の開発者が指摘しているように、AIモデル自体の使用コストは非常に変動します。開発とテスト中に1日あたり数百ドルを費やしたと報告するユーザーもいます。このAPIコールごとのモデルは、予算を立てるのが非常に難しく、月々の請求書にいくつかの厄介な驚きをもたらす可能性があります。
eesel AI vs. Claude Code SDKでの構築
ここで大きな疑問が浮かびます:本当にゼロからこれを構築する必要がありますか?数ヶ月のエンジニアリング作業、セキュリティリスク、予測不可能なコストなしでカスタムビルトのAIエージェントのすべての力を得ることができたらどうでしょうか?ここで、eesel AIのようなAI統合プラットフォームが登場します。
ゼロから構築する代わりに、すべての重労働を処理するプラットフォームを手に入れ、インフラストラクチャではなく結果に集中できます。
| 機能 | Claude Code SDKでの構築 | eesel AIの使用 |
|---|---|---|
| ライブまでの時間 | 数週間から数ヶ月 | 数分 |
| 必要なスキル | シニアソフトウェアエンジニア、AI/プロンプトエンジニアリング | コード不要、ダッシュボードで設定 |
| 知識ソース | カスタムMCPサーバーを介した手動統合 | 100以上のワンクリック統合(Zendesk、Confluenceなど) |
| テストと安全性 | 開発者による手動コーディングとテスト | 過去のチケットでのシミュレーションモード内蔵 |
| 制御とカスタマイズ | コードを介した完全な制御、開発が必要 | ビジュアルワークフローエンジン、プロンプトエディタ、カスタムアクション |
| 価格モデル | 変動、APIコールごと | 予測可能、インタラクションごとのプラン |
これが現実世界で何を意味するのかを解き明かしましょう。
このAnthropicの公式ビデオは、Claude Code SDKを使用してAIエージェントを構築およびプロトタイプ化するための開発者向けのウォークスルーを提供します。
数ヶ月ではなく数分で始める
SDKはチームにインストールコマンドを実行し、多くのPythonまたはTypeScriptコードを書くことを要求しますが、eesel AIはヘルプデスクや知識ソースに数クリックで接続します。数分でデータから学び、顧客の質問に答える完全に機能するAIエージェントを持つことができます。
コードなしで制御を維持
SDKは細かい制御を提供しますが、すべてをコードの行で管理する必要があります。eesel AIは、AIのペルソナを定義し、知識を特定のソースに限定し、カスタムアクションを作成するための直感的なワークフローエンジンを提供します。コーディングは不要です。
瞬時にすべての知識を接続
SDKベースのエージェントを本当に有用にするには、エンジニアが使用するすべての知識ソースに対してカスタム統合を構築する必要がありますが、これは大規模な取り組みです。eesel AIは、過去のサポートチケット、Confluenceページ、Google Docsなどにすぐに接続し、すべての知識を一元化して、初日から正確でコンテキストに基づいた回答を提供します。
安全にテストしてみる
カスタムビルトのエージェントをテストすることは、暗闇の中での一発勝負のように感じることがあります。eesel AIのシミュレーションモードを使用すると、実際の顧客とやり取りする前に、過去の数千のチケットでAIをテストできます。これにより、そのパフォーマンスと自動化率の明確な予測が得られ、何を期待するかを正確に知った上で立ち上げることができます。
Claude Code SDK: 強力だが実用的か?
では、結論はどうでしょうか?Claude Code SDKは非常に有能で柔軟なツールキットです。専任のエンジニアリングチームを持ち、深くカスタマイズされたコード重視のAIエージェントを構築する本当の必要性がある企業にとっては、素晴らしい選択です。
しかし、そのすべての力は、時間、継続的な複雑さ、予測不可能な支出という形で高額な代償を伴います。
ほとんどの企業にとって、AIインフラストラクチャの構築に精通することが目標ではありません。目標は、AIが約束するビジネス成果を得ることです:より迅速な解決、より満足した顧客、より生産的なチーム。
eesel AIのようなプラットフォームは、それらの成果を迅速、安全、かつ手頃な価格で達成するためのはるかに直接的な道を提供します。エンジニアリングの頭痛なしでAIのすべての利点を得ることができます。
今日からAIエージェントを始めましょう
サポートを自動化し、トリアージを合理化し、チームにAIの力を与える準備はできていますか?eesel AIの無料トライアルを開始し、5分以内に最初のAIエージェントを展開しましょう。
よくある質問
コストの予測は大きな課題です。価格はAPIコールごとの使用量に基づいているため、エージェントの活動に応じて請求額が変動し、開発やテストだけでも高額になる可能性があります。予測可能な支出を望む場合、固定価格プランを持つプラットフォームがより安全な選択肢となることが多いです。
PythonまたはTypeScriptに精通し、AIプロンプトや複雑なAPI統合の経験を持つシニアエンジニアが必要です。これはジュニア開発者が担当するタスクではなく、効果的に管理するためには特定の高いスキルセットが求められます。
SDKを使用する際のセキュリティは完全にあなたのチームの責任です。開発者は、エージェントがアクセスまたは変更できる内容を制御するために、厳格なコードベースの権限とガードレールを記述する必要があります。これには、ミスを防ぐための慎重な計画と厳密なテストが必要です。
サポートエージェントを構築することは可能ですが、SDKは汎用ツールキットであるため、すべてをゼロから構築する必要があります。カスタマーサポートの自動化のような特定の機能には、ヘルプデスクやナレッジベースへの接続が既に用意されている専門プラットフォームの方が実用的です。
継続的なメンテナンスを計画する必要があります。内部システム、API、またはドキュメントが変更されると、エージェントが壊れたり古い情報を提供したりしないように、開発者が更新する必要があります。これは一度きりのプロジェクトではなく、継続的な運用コストです。






